Corporate Development Analyst will be responsible for:
Strategy Development and Implementation
Support our annual strategy planning process: develop strategy materials (PowerPoints) summarizing market developments, financial performance, product comparison, and key strategic questions
Help frame issues and strategic initiatives through financial modeling (eg, identifying highest ROE areas for investment, financial effects of key strategic initiatives, etc); work with business intelligence and finance to develop and vet data and analysis underpinning strategic issues and decisions
Track and analyze market trends including technology developments, market-leading research, and peer strategic activities
The Corporate Development Analyst should have the following qualifications:
2-3 years experience in investment banking/mergers & acquisitions, family office, private equity, or management consulting at the analyst or associate level
Strong analytical and financial modeling skills; proficiency in Excel
Strong presentation development skills; high proficiency in PowerPoint and Word
Familiarity in reading financial statements and understanding basic accounting principles
Complex problem-solving skills; innovative with the ability to create differentiated analysis based on the situation
Undergraduate degree in finance, economics, computer science, or other business fields
